Primality and Factorization

333721 is a prime number — it has no positive divisors other than 1 and itself. Prime numbers are the fundamental building blocks of all integers, as stated by the Fundamental Theorem of Arithmetic: every integer greater than 1 can be uniquely expressed as a product of primes. The importance of primes extends far beyond pure mathematics — they are the foundation of modern cryptography, including the RSA algorithm that secures online banking, e-commerce, and private communications across the internet.

The closest primes to 333721 are: the previous prime 333719 and the next prime 333737. The gap between 333721 and its neighboring primes can reveal interesting patterns in the distribution of prime numbers, a topic central to analytic number theory and closely related to the famous Riemann Hypothesis.

Digit Properties

The digits of 333721 sum to 19, and its digital root (the single-digit value obtained by repeatedly summing digits) is 1. The number 333721 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.

Cryptographic Hashes

When the string “333721” is passed through standard cryptographic hash functions, the results are: MD5: 8ce39da0a0314764efad730a5c56ffad, SHA-1: 47b514b7cbd348174d0dd673f2089e44bc25e0a2, SHA-256: 648524383c66145a4b44e6138a86b06e3ab42f56257149acf663812d2299adea, and SHA-512: ac9f69d53680db5836141ae6873ca91576b414fc0dd45d4489606d895578c1fe86942a2a87be585732330286d0c9e2cd73c2ce84c6205d5c11a5e57af9a92852. Cryptographic hashes are one-way functions that produce a fixed-size output from any input. They are used for data integrity verification (detecting file corruption or tampering), password storage (storing hashes instead of plaintext passwords), digital signatures, blockchain technology (Bitcoin uses SHA-256), and content addressing (Git uses SHA-1 to identify objects).

Collatz Conjecture

The Collatz conjecture (also known as the 3n + 1 problem) is one of the most famous unsolved problems in mathematics. Starting from 333721 and repeatedly applying the rule — divide by 2 if even, multiply by 3 and add 1 if odd — the sequence reaches 1 in 114 steps. Despite its simplicity, no one has been able to prove that this process always terminates for every starting number, and the conjecture remains open since it was first proposed by Lothar Collatz in 1937.
